We’ve all heard of speed dating, but how about speed friending? Ozark Beer Company is not only making great craft beer, but also making opportunities to connect people within the community to make new friends. This "speed friending" event works like speed dating, but with the objective of making new friends. As we age, it may feel more and more difficult to create real, genuine friendships. And having friends is important to us both physically and mentally. According to William Chopik, a professor of psychology at Michigan State University, “friendships become even more important as we age. Keeping a few really good friends around can make a world of difference for our health and well-being.”

Music Moves and the Northwest Arkansas Jazz Society are partnering with Crowne Group and the City of Rogers office of Arts and Culture to host the inaugural Railyard Jazz & Blues Block Party Friday, July 29 and Saturday, July 30, 2022. This is part of the Railyard Live Concert Series presented by iHeartRadio at Butterfield Stage in Downtown Rogers. The two day event is designed to bring the community together in a celebration of Jazz, Blues, R&B, and Soul music.

Each year, the Daisy Airgun Museum creates a custom engraving for the annual Downtown Rogers, Arkansas, Limited Edition Model 25 BB gun. This is a fully functional Model 25 Daisy BB gun with laser engraving on the stock.  This year, Daisy chose to highlight the Opera Block, located at the Southwest corner of Walnut and First Streets in our Historic Downtown.  The annual issue of this and gun will be closed when 500 guns have been produced or on the last business day of 2022, whichever comes first. The gun includes an insert card about the image and building.

David and Holly King decided to pursue an adventure in jewelry design and repair in NW Arkansas in late 2019.  As a self-taught jeweler with a background in mechanics and metalsmithing, David began to build a business model to help solve the perception that owning custom jewelry is only for the affluent. “Custom jewelry should be available for anyone wanting to express their personality or style without an inflated price tag,” explained Holly. The couple designs each individual piece with the customer in mind using their skills and talent to make each piece unique. With the help of Computer Aided Design (CAD) and international sourcing of gemstones and diamonds, the Kings strive to offer a relaxed, stress-free shopping experience where beautiful, custom jewelry is affordable.

Nicole’s House is a faith-based nonprofit, dedicated to helping women transition back into their community while they recover from drug and alcohol addiction. Located on N 3rd Street in Downtown Rogers, the organization provides mentoring, instructions for daily living, and career counseling. Nicole’s house is a place where women can recover from the torment and destruction of addiction, and return to their community as successful contributing members of their city.

Event organizers announced the BITE NW Arkansas food festival will return this summer and fall as a three-part event series in conjunction with the Walmart NW Arkansas Championship presented by P&G. The series will feature events in Downtown Rogers (July 29), Springdale (September 1) and onsite at Pinnacle Country Club (September 23-25) during #NWAChampionship Week.

Since the event’s inception in 2015, the festival has celebrated the region’s best cuisines, restaurants and chefs, giving attendees an elevated culinary experience in their own backyard. Traditionally, held in one location during #NWAChampionship Week, the expanded series will move to various locations throughout the region with both daytime and evening culinary experiences for the community to enjoy.

The 2022 #BITENWA Event Series will kickoff in Downtown Rogers on Friday, July 29 with a one-night event at Frisco Plaza. Monica McCleary and Jessy Duque are bringing the newest addition to the Downtown Rogers creative community as they prepare to open Cirro Studio. As business partners and life heart-ners, they create fine wood furniture and housewares, keeping a high focus on detail with an emphasis on design. Using traditional furniture-making practices, they take pride constructing beautiful heirloom quality wood furniture that is inspired by the functionality of the Shakers and minimalism of the Danish modern design movement.
